Transaction 8a7dabe09f60ce8b1f21d67ca02703b7a8f48c65ee18b3ed323bef95ebf93755
1 Input
1 Output
-
8a7dabe09f60ce8b1f21d67ca02703b7a8f48c65ee18b3ed323bef95ebf93755:0
- value
- 13679889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c625442e50b957abfca1d6855d4e3aa10effa44 OP_EQUAL
- address
- MHnF1BCeT2iDPkSxuPknhsXCfM3q1Xd4mu